Output 75c517a93621637e190fa65d6ff9ac35bb71c9c0e9bc5b4a1be740e147a74eff:1

value
1488549
script pubkey
OP_0 OP_PUSHBYTES_20 3eef386c8a23dcfe8ae17f2c5e2112062f29ec1b
address
bc1q8mhnsmy2y0w0azhp0uk9uggjqchjnmqmtrdn28
transaction
75c517a93621637e190fa65d6ff9ac35bb71c9c0e9bc5b4a1be740e147a74eff